IRWINDALE, CALIF. — Bonduelle is catering to the lifestyles of college students and young professionals with a new line of ready-to-eat Lunch Bowls.

The grab-and-go Lunch Bowls are shelf stable and can be eaten hot or cold, Bonduelle said.

"We know that the majority (77%) of Gen Z live busy lifestyles and are looking for quick and easy meal options that don't sacrifice on taste,” said Bobby Chacko, CEO, Bonduelle Americas. “They want high-quality solutions that deliver more than just fuel, they want something that excites them. And that's exactly why we created these Lunch Bowls. With no artificial preservatives, these bowls prove you don't have to compromise on quality or taste, no matter how busy your schedule is."

The bowls come in four flavors inspired by global cuisines:

Southwest Fusion

“The perfect combo of bold and spicy, featuring two types of quinoa, chickpeas, and sweet roasted corn. We added a kick of chili pepper because basic just won't cut it when you're this hungry.”

Mediterranean Fusion

“Fresh herbs and garlic bring nutty farro and tender black-eyed peas to life in this Mediterranean-inspired bowl. With grilled veggies and briny green olives in the mix, this bowl hits different.”

Indian Fusion

“Warm aromatic spices meet perfectly cooked bulgur and lentils. Topped with roasted veggies and sweet cherry tomatoes, it's the satisfying meal that'll have everyone asking, ‘What's in your bowl?!’”

The Lunch Bowl launch is supported by pop-ups at Southern California universities including UCLA, UC Irvine, and USC, Bonduelle said.

Bonduelle also plans to fully integrate its Ready Pac products with the Bonduelle brand by July 2025.

Bonduelle also seeks to support its Southern California community. In January, the company donated Lunch Bowls to fire crews and evacuees affected by the LA fires.
